Nominations for the next round of Governors elections now open

If you would like to join our Council of Governors then you’ll be interested to learn that we are currently seeking Governors for the following areas:

  • Public - The Black Country (x2)
  • Clinical (Other)
  • Non-clinical
  • Midwifery

Our Governors represent our patients, staff, partner organisations and the public and meet four times a year to discuss the business of our hospital to help shape plans and ensure that the needs of our children, women and families and our staff are fully considered.

Becoming Governor is a great opportunity for you to represent the views of local people, patients or your colleagues. No special skills are needed - the great thing about the Council of Governors is the diverse range of experience, skills and expertise it brings.  The important thing is to have a passion for representing the interests of people who use or work in the NHS and to be committed to our values which are Ambitious, Brave and Compassionate.

We’d like you to commit around three hours every month to the position, mainly in the evening, and be available to attend four formal council meetings a year. No experience is necessary - full support, guidance and training are given by our Company Secretary team.
